Understanding the Sterility Testing Challenge
Traditional cleanroom environments face inherent limitations in maintaining continuous Class 100 cleanliness standards. Manual production processes introduce significant risks of external and cross-contamination, creating vulnerabilities that can compromise entire production batches. The pharmaceutical industry has long recognized these pain points: maintaining stable sterile conditions requires not just clean air, but complete physical separation between operators and critical processes.
This is where isolation technology fundamentally changes the equation. By creating a fully enclosed operating environment, sterility testing isolators eliminate the primary contamination vectors that plague conventional cleanroom setups. Engineering Excellence in Design and Construction
The construction methodology of the KuTe Series reflects pharmaceutical industry best practices. The system features entirely stainless steel construction with tempered glass doors, a design choice that ensures both durability and ease of sterilization. Stainless steel's non-porous surface prevents microbial colonization and withstands repeated exposure to aggressive cleaning agents and sterilization procedures.
The inflatable sealing strips utilized throughout the system represent a critical innovation. Unlike traditional gasket seals that can degrade over time, inflatable seals maintain consistent compression and airtightness across the operational lifecycle. When inflated, these seals create a positive barrier that maintains the internal positive pressure environment essential for preventing external contamination ingress.
The laminar airflow system deserves particular attention. By directing filtered air in a top-down unidirectional flow pattern, the system continuously sweeps particulates away from the work surface and products. This creates what the industry recognizes as a self-cleaning environment, where contamination risks are actively minimized through continuous air exchange and particle removal.

Industry Applications and Validated Use Cases
The KuTe Series serves two primary operational contexts within the pharmaceutical industry. In aseptic manufacturing operations, the isolator provides the controlled environment necessary for producing sterile pharmaceutical products, particularly for processes involving filling, assembly, or manipulation of sterile components. The physical separation eliminates operator-introduced contamination risks while maintaining the continuous Grade A environment required by regulatory authorities.
For quality control laboratories conducting sterility testing, the KuTe Series ensures consistent sterile conditions for high-sensitivity pharmaceutical inspections. Sterility testing represents one of the most critical quality control procedures in pharmaceutical manufacturing—any environmental contamination during testing can produce false results that either incorrectly fail compliant products or, more dangerously, incorrectly pass contaminated products. The isolator's stable environment eliminates these risks.
Regulatory Compliance and Standards Alignment
The pharmaceutical industry operates under stringent regulatory frameworks, with G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ice) guidelines defining acceptable manufacturing and testing environments. The KuTe Series demonstrates GMP Grade A cleanliness standard compliance, meeting international pharmaceutical manufacturing requirements.
The system's capability to maintain Class 100 cleanliness standards positions it among the most stringent environmental control solutions available. Class 100 designation indicates that each cubic foot of air contains no more than 100 particles of 0.5 microns or larger—a threshold that requires sophisticated filtration and airflow management to achieve consistently.
